Fire Accident In KRR's Shoot, Kills One

Veteran director K Raghavendra Rao's latest film 'Intinti Annamaya' shooting in Araku valley has cost the life of a Camera assistant today.

As the makers pulled electricity to the shooting spot from the nearby Borra village, they have neglected taking proper care about the insulation of wires. A live wire got touched with ground and caused a short circuit, breaking a fire, said a source from unit. A camera assistant named Bhanu Prakash has lost his life in this unfortunate incident. Movie unit has remained tight lipped about the event, and is not available for a comment.

'Sri Rama Rajyam' producer Yelamanchili Saibabu is the producer of this flick and his son Revanth is debuting as hero.
